COMMON WARNING SIGNS

Foundation Problems We Repair

A foundation issue can appear in several parts of the home. These are some of the most common signs Fort Saskatchewan homeowners should not ignore.

01

Foundation Wall Cracks

Vertical, horizontal, diagonal, and stair-step cracks may be caused by shrinkage, settlement, water pressure, or structural movement.

02

Basement Water Leaks

Water entering after rainfall or snowmelt can damage finished walls, flooring, insulation, and stored belongings.

03

Bowing Foundation Walls

Walls that lean or bow inward may be under pressure from saturated soil and should be inspected before movement increases.

04

Slab and Floor Cracks

Concrete floor cracks can develop from settlement, shrinkage, soil movement, or moisture conditions beneath the slab.

05

Uneven Floors and Settlement

Sloping floors, sticking doors, and separated trim can indicate movement in the structure or supporting soil.

06

Musty Basement Odours

Persistent odours, dampness, and white mineral deposits can indicate hidden moisture behind walls or under flooring.

LOCAL FOUNDATION CONDITIONS

Why Foundations Move in Fort Saskatchewan

Alberta homes experience significant seasonal changes. Moisture levels rise during snowmelt and heavy rain, while winter freezing and dry periods change conditions in the soil around the foundation. These changes can contribute to settlement, cracking, seepage, and pressure against basement walls.

1
Freeze-Thaw Cycles

Water in soil and foundation cracks can freeze, expand, and contribute to gradual movement or deterioration.

2
Spring Snowmelt

Melting snow can release water while parts of the ground are still frozen, increasing runoff around the home.

3
Heavy Rainfall

Saturated soil can create hydrostatic pressure against basement walls, cracks, and the wall-floor joint.

4
Drainage and Grading Problems

Settled soil, short downspouts, clogged weeping tile, or poor sump discharge can keep water close to the foundation.

Foundation cracks are one of the earliest warning signs that something may be affecting your home's structural integrity or waterproofing system. While some hairline cracks are part of normal concrete curing, wider or leaking cracks often indicate settlement, hydrostatic pressure, or movement around the foundation.

Vertical Foundation Cracks

Often caused by normal concrete shrinkage or minor settlement but should still be inspected if water is present.

Horizontal Foundation Cracks

Can indicate excessive soil pressure against basement walls and may require structural reinforcement.

Stair-Step Cracks

Common in block foundations and often associated with settlement or movement beneath the home.

Leaking Foundation Cracks

Water entering through cracks should be repaired promptly before moisture causes mould or interior damage.
